The dissertation analyses how the mode of EU negotiations is influenced by actors' preferences. It poses the question when we have intergovernmental and when supranational modes of negotiations and why. The causal framework establishes that there is a causal link between mode of negotiations (the dependent variable) and actors' preferences (the independent variable) in the context of the formal and informal rules. It postulates that congruence of preferences among member states and supranational actors leads to a supranational mode of negotiations. On the other hand, in cases when there is a perceived threat to the vital national interests of a particular member state(s), the intergovernmental mode of negotiations will apply. This hypothesis is tested on the case of Slovenia's accession negotiations of chapters environments and free movement of persons.
